A week ago I changed out the bulbs on my TX5 and got the following:
2 Giesseman Aquablue +
2 Giesseman Actnitic +
1 Giesseman Midday
I just noticed that the Midday bulb doesn't even appear to be on, so took out all the other bulbs (so I don't blind myself) and tried just running the Midday - I can tell it does come on, but it is VERY dim so I can't really see this providing any useful light to the tank. I've also tried the bulb in another slot with the same result (other bulbs are just as bright in it's slot)
I know the Midday bulb is only 6000k, is this the reason it is so dim? Or is there a chance that it is a defective bulb? I've never used the Midday bulb before so I'm not sure how bright it's supposed to be.
